The brand isn't quite as important as the type/line of helmet. Any of the "racer" helmets are going to be lighter than a regular lid. Case in point... a Shoei X-11 (Shoei's top-of-the-line race helmet) is lighter than the Shoei RF-1000. Same with the Arai Corsair (another "race" helmet) as opposed to the Arai Quantum. More importantly is to find one that fits your head correctly. With no pressure points. I wear a Shoei RF-1000, but none of the Arai's fit my head right (at least the ones I have tried). And it seems to be true for most. You'll hear about someone having either a Shoei head or a Arai head. When you find one that fits your head perfectly, stop looking. Hopefully it won't be an expensive one. I went to Cycle Gear and tried on all their lids. Once I found that the RF-1000 fit my head, I shopped eBay and got my lid for less than half retail price.
